The Lambs have beaten off a number of competitors to obtain the signature of 25 year old midfielder Richard Baker who last season was on the books of Barrow FC. The midfielder who scored over 10 goals with the Bluebirds has also played over 140 games in the Football League having been on the books of Oxford United and Bury FC. Richard began career on books of Manchester United. The team is now taking shape and any further signings will be put on hold whilst Manager Dale Belford flies out to Bulgaria to play in an Old Stars Xl for Aston Villa who will be playing a Bulgarian national Xl in a game which will be shown live on Bulgarian TV. Former Lamb Lee Hendrie is also in the squad traveling to Sofia for the game. After the Bank Holiday weekend venture Dale will be back in the office on Wednesday looking to finalise a number of other potential signings. |

The Lambs have cut back on the number of pre-season fixtures that they had played prior to the start of last season. The following games have now been arranged but are all subject to change. The opening fixture is a short drive down the A5 to Atherstone Town on Tuesday 8th July for a game kicking off at 7.30pm. On Saturday 13th the team will be playing a West Bromwich Albion Xl away which will be played behind closed doors. Supporters will be able to watch the team on Monday 15th July when Kevin McDonald and former Lambs Manager Mark Cooper will be sending their full Swindon Town first team to the Lamb for a game kicking off at 7.30pm. |

The Lambs are pleased to announce that after spending two loan spells at the club 19 year old defender Matthew Regan has signed a one season deal with the club after his release from Nottingham Forest FC. Matthew has captained England at various youth levels including the Under 17 World Cup when England reached the Quarter Final. Prior to his spell with Forest Matthew was on the books of Liverpool for three seasons after they had paid Wrexham a nominal fee for his services. |
